CSIT-428: Add kernel parameters to ansible-host 44/3244/2
authorpmikus <pmikus@cisco.com>
Tue, 4 Oct 2016 11:10:48 +0000 (12:10 +0100)
committerPeter Mikus <pmikus@cisco.com>
Wed, 5 Oct 2016 04:10:44 +0000 (04:10 +0000)
- Add kernel parameter to isolate cpus into ansible SUT host section

Change-Id: I856f6eca6464d4dd513c0dd2d44a153493c35c99
Signed-off-by: pmikus <pmikus@cisco.com>
resources/tools/testbed-setup/playbooks/01-host-setup.yaml

index de32beb..4640260 100644 (file)
@@ -82,7 +82,7 @@
   - name: Install dkms
     apt: name=dkms state=present
   - name: isolcpus and pstate parameter
-    lineinfile: dest=/etc/default/grub regexp=^GRUB_CMDLINE_LINUX= line=GRUB_CMDLINE_LINUX="\"isolcpus={{ isolcpus }} intel_pstate=disable\""
+    lineinfile: dest=/etc/default/grub regexp=^GRUB_CMDLINE_LINUX= line=GRUB_CMDLINE_LINUX="\"isolcpus={{ isolcpus }} nohz_full={{ nohz }} rcu_nocbs={{ rcu }} intel_pstate=disable\""
   - name: update grub
     command: update-grub
   - name: Install pkg-config